This section is about cabinet makers - woodworkers, and their different backgrounds.

Vladimir Grischenko, a native of the Ukraine, began his lifetime of woodworking at his grandfather's, a shoe maker's, side, making the wood forms that shoes were constructed on in that time. After graduating from a university and the military, Vladimir married and began the bold move of immigrating to the USA via Israel, where he further honed his woodworking and finishing skills. Upon arriving in the USA, he worked a few finish carpentry jobs and eventually opened a cabinet shop of his own. Keeping with the values that were instilled in him from early on, he truly believes that all parts of our daily lives should be as beautiful as they are useful. Mitchell Henige began his career in an entirely different manner. Born and raised in rural MI, his family instilled in him a never give up, hard-working attitude. After graduating high school, he worked for a friend's father framing homes. After some years, he moved on to a larger construction company where he began to learn the finish carpentry trade. When the owner of this company was killed in a boating accident, Mitchell was faced with a decision to be an employee or become the employer. After considerable thought and some consultation with an uncle who owned a very successful woodworking business and began his career in a similar fashion, Mitchell made the decision to be an employer. After about 15 years of concentrating on installing custom interior trim and cabinets, Mitchell began to make cabinets to specifications. In 2003, the economy began to slow, and he equipped a shop in order to concentrate more on cabinets and custom moldings. Custom Cabinetry Design began as a concept in about 2000, when Vlad and Mitch crossed paths. Mitch was installing custom cabinets made by Vlad's Company and they began addressing the issues associated with designing, manufacturing, and installing custom cabinets. After many years of making sawdust and collaborating on countless projects together, we believe that we have come up with a system from design through final installation that addresses most problems encountered with custom cabinetry. The differences you can recognize

About professional cabinet makers and woodworkers

  • The cabinet doors are correctly glued (both parts receive glue)
  • The doors' insert panels are prefinished edges (for wood movement with no line when panel moves)
  • The mitered doors will not crack on the glue joint (original methods)
  • The door thickness is 21mm (1.5 mm or 1/16 thicker than mass production allows for greater edge detail and more gluing surface)
  • The cabinet box is 100% made from 3/4" (18.5 mm) prefinished, healthy plywood (formaldehyde free)
  • Drawer boxes are 5/8" (15 mm) solid wood, 1/2" (12mm) bottom (very solid, little deflection)
  • 95% of cabinet parts are finished horizontally (pleasure to touch)
  • Engineered by design assembling methods (over 25 years of satisfaction)
  • Totally hidden wires, under cabinet lighting system (original and very clean)
  • Flawless installation and components indication (precision parts will fit precisely)
